Five killed, Four injured in blast at Cochin Shipyard

In Kerala, five workers were killed and four injured in a blast that occurred in the maintenance dock of Cochin Shipyard today.
 
The blast occurred inside ONGC ship, Sagar Bhusan which was under maintenance in the dock.
 
All the injured workers have been admitted to hospital. The condition of one injured is reportedly critical.
 
AIR Correspondent reports, the situation is under control now.
 
Minister of Shipping, Nitin Gadkari has directed MD Cochin Shipyard to provide all medical support to victims and initiate enquiry into the incident.
